- Quickfix on EntityTrait annotations removal

This commit is contained in:
Dave Mc Nicoll 2023-11-08 09:28:26 -05:00
parent f6d86001d5
commit a3f174b7f3
1 changed files with 4 additions and 10 deletions

View File

@ -2,26 +2,20 @@
namespace Ulmus\Ldap;
use Ulmus\{ Ulmus, EventTrait, Query, Common\EntityResolver, Common\EntityField };
use Ulmus\{Attribute\Property\Field, Ulmus, EventTrait, Query, Common\EntityResolver, Common\EntityField};
use Ulmus\Ldap\Annotation\Classes\{ ObjectClass, ObjectType, };
trait EntityTrait {
use \Ulmus\EntityTrait;
/**
* @Id('readonly' => true)
*/
#[Field\Id(readonly: true)]
public string $dn;
/**
* @Field
*/
#[Field]
public string $cn;
/**
* @Field
*/
#[Field]
public array $objectClass;
public static function resolveEntity() : EntityResolver